site stats

Elasticsearch index mapping array

WebElasticsearch Mapping - Mapping is the outline of the documents stored in an index. It defines the data type like geo_point or string and format of the fields present in the … WebThe latest version of Elasticsearch provides a new way to optimize the index. Using the shrink API, it's possible to reduce the number of shards of an index. This feature targets several common scenarios: There will be the wrong number of shards during the initial design sizing. Often, sizing the shards without knowing the correct data or text ...

How to Do a Mapping of Array of Strings in Elasticsearch

WebMar 8, 2024 · OpenSearch / ElasticSearch index mappings. Ask Question Asked 1 year, 1 month ago. Modified 1 year, 1 month ago. Viewed 761 times 0 I have a system that ingests multiple scores for events and we use opensearch (previously elastic search) for getting the averages. For example, an input would be similar to: ... WebNov 28, 2024 · The structure of the array of objects has been flattened into arrays containing values for specific fields of objects. So, despite John Doe not being a … food thermometers fda https://jtwelvegroup.com

Elasticsearch Mapping - How to View, Create or Update Mapping …

WebMar 22, 2024 · Both are set as “object” type fields. This means Elasticsearch will flatten the properties. Document 1 will look like this: As you can see, the “tags” field looks like a regular string array, but the “authors” field looks different – it was split into many array fields. The issue with this is that Elasticsearch is not storing each ... WebI have a problem with querying objects in array. Let's create very simple index, add a type with one field and add one document with array of objects (I use sense console): ... mapping social relation elasticsearch. 3. ElasticSearch search for part of … WebMapping arrays. An array or multi-value fields are very common in data models (such as multiple phone numbers, addresses, names, aliases, and so on), but not natively supported in traditional SQL solutions. In SQL, multi-value fields require the creation of accessory tables that must be joined to gather all the values, leading to poor ... electric knife sharpeners amazon

How To Index Array of Objects in Elasticsearch (Code …

Category:Elasticsearch如何修改Mapping结构并实现业务零停机 - 知乎

Tags:Elasticsearch index mapping array

Elasticsearch index mapping array

Refreshing an index Elasticsearch 7.0 Cookbook - Fourth Edition

WebMapping base types; Mapping arrays; Mapping an object; Mapping a document; Using dynamic templates in document mapping; Managing nested objects; ... Refreshing an index. Elasticsearch allows the user to control the state of the searcher using a forced refresh on an index. WebMar 26, 2024 · If the mapping is set to the wrong type, re-creating the index with updated mapping and re- indexing is the only option available. In version 7.0, Elasticsearch has deprecated the document type and the default document type is set to _doc. In future versions of Elasticsearch, the document type will be removed completely.

Elasticsearch index mapping array

Did you know?

Web在项目中后期,如果想调整索引的 Mapping 结构,比如将 ik_smart 修改为 ik_max_word 或者 增加分片数量 等,但 Elasticsearch 不允许这样修改呀,怎么办?. 常规 解决方法:. 根据最新的 Mapping 结构再创建一个索引. 将旧索引的数据全量导入到新索引中. 告知用户,业务 … WebDynamic mapping allows you to experiment with and explore data when you’re just getting started. Elasticsearch adds new fields automatically, just by indexing a document. You …

WebExplicit mapping edit. Explicit mapping. You know more about your data than Elasticsearch can guess, so while dynamic mapping can be useful to get started, at some point you will want to specify your own explicit mappings. You can create field mappings when you create an index and add fields to an existing index. WebMapping arrays. An array or multi-value fields are very common in data models (such as multiple phone numbers, addresses, names, aliases, and so on), but not natively …

WebDec 15, 2024 · 撰寫 mapping 其實不是這麼容易,除了可以參考 API 來撰寫之外,也可以透過寫入一些 sample data 到一個臨時的 index,讓 Elasticsearch 自動產生 mapping 定義後,再根據實際需求進行修改。 Index Options. Inverted Index 根據要記錄的內容,有四種 index options 可以設定: WebApr 26, 2016 · Geo mapping. Prior to index any geo mapped data (or calling the synchronize), the mapping must be manualy created with the createMapping (see above). First, in your schema, define 'geo_cords' this way:

WebThe index.mapping.dimension_fields.limit index setting limits the number of dimensions ... The doc_values and index mapping parameters must be true. Field values cannot be an array or multi-value. Field values cannot be larger than 1024 bytes. The field cannot use ... Elasticsearch analyzes text fields to return the most relevant results for ...

WebDynamic templates are similar to the usual mappings. Each template has its pattern defined, which is applied to the document's field names. If a field matches the pattern, the template is used. The pattern can be defined in a few ways: match: The template is used if the name of the field matches the pattern. electric knife sharpeners ukWebApr 5, 2024 · ElasticSearch indexing and mapping arrays. 8. failed to parse field [datefield] of type [date] 1. ... How to define multiple analyzers for an elasticsearch index via NEST client fluent syntax. Hot Network Questions If I suddenly store a lot of energy in a small space, this induces spacetime curvature. ... electric knife slicerWebJun 25, 2014 · Надеюсь, что я смог доходчиво рассказать о главных функциях mapping'a в ES. Если у вас есть вопросы, рад буду ответить. Другие статьи по ES: ElasticSearch — агрегация данных ElasticSearch и electric knife sharpener serratedWebMapping arrays. An array or a multivalue field is very common in data models (such as multiple phone numbers, addresses, names, aliases, and so on), but it is not natively supported in traditional SQL solutions. In SQL, multivalue fields require the creation of accessory tables that must be joined in order to gather all the values, leading to ... electric knife singaporeWebDiscuss the Elastic Stack - Official ELK / Elastic Stack, Elasticsearch ... food thermometers for saleWebElasticsearch Mapping - Mapping is the outline of the documents stored in an index. It defines the data type like geo_point or string and format of the fields present in the documents and rules to control the mapping of dynamically added fields. ... These include array, JSON object and nested data type. An example of nested data type is shown ... electric knife sharpener serrated kniveshttp://joelabrahamsson.com/elasticsearch-nested-mapping-and-filter/ electric knife sharpeners sale